It's the Zoning, Stupid w/ Juan Castillo
Juan Castillo (Zoned Out Planner) delves into the complexities of zoning laws and their impact on housing, inequality, and urban planning. Juan explains the basics of zoning, its historical context, and how it has evolved to contribute to social disparities. The discussion highlights current trends in zoning reforms, the importance of public participation, and the role of local government in addressing the housing crisis. Juan emphasizes the need for gentle density as a solution to increase housing options and affordability, while also encouraging community engagement in zoning decisions.
